BU Men's Soccer Picks Up First Win of Season in Home Opener
Coming into the week, BU men's soccer was 0-3, but in the Bearcats' home opener, they pulled out a 3-1 win against St. Bonaventure.
The first half saw both teams suffer from a scoring drought. BU put up 10 shots, Bonaventure three, none of which found the back of the net.
However, in the second half, BU scored early in the 49th minute as Anthony Lazaridis found the cage off a Michael Bush assist.
Minutes later in the 63rd, Jack Green scored off a solo shot high on the woodwork to make it 2-0.
That's when the Bonnies got back into the game, scoring just three minutes later to cut the Binghamton lead in half.
But the nail in the coffin came in the 78th with a Markos Touroukis goal to make it 3-1.
Dylan McDermott played the entire game with a relatively quiet game in net, allowing one goal and picking up just one save.
